For avid travellers, the news about Boracay Island Closure for 6 months that started in April 2018 has been known. It was an effort of the government to clean up and bring back the beauty of the Island. It was recently declared as an agrarian reform area, that will be distributed to the local owners (particularly IPs) and limit construction of more facilities that can destroy the natural beauty of the Island. Kudos to the Government of the Philippines for ensuring a travel-worthy experience to the one of the most beautiful beach Island in the world. If all things get right, it will finally resume and open to the public in October 2018, with travel conditionalities that remain to be known to us.
